Comerica (CMA) Interest Deposits: 2009-2019
Historic Interest Deposits for Comerica (CMA) over the last 11 years, with Dec 2019 value amounting to $4.8 billion.
- Comerica's Interest Deposits rose 251.56% to $10.2 billion in Q3 2020 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2020 it was $10.2 billion, marking a year-over-year increase of 251.56%. This contributed to the annual value of $4.8 billion for FY2019, which is 52.79% up from last year.
- As of FY2019, Comerica's Interest Deposits stood at $4.8 billion, which was up 52.79% from $3.2 billion recorded in FY2018.
- In the past 5 years, Comerica's Interest Deposits ranged from a high of $6.0 billion in FY2016 and a low of $3.2 billion during FY2018.
- Its 3-year average for Interest Deposits is $4.1 billion, with a median of $4.4 billion in 2017.
- Its Interest Deposits has fluctuated over the past 5 years, first fell by 28.05% in 2018, then skyrocketed by 52.79% in 2019.
- Yearly analysis of 5 years shows Comerica's Interest Deposits stood at $5.0 billion in 2015, then increased by 19.62% to $6.0 billion in 2016, then decreased by 26.17% to $4.4 billion in 2017, then fell by 28.05% to $3.2 billion in 2018, then spiked by 52.79% to $4.8 billion in 2019.
